Given numbers are 492, 809, 115, 645
The list of prime factors of all numbers are
Prime factors of 492 are 2 x 2 x 3 x 41
Prime factors of 809 are 809
Prime factors of 115 are 5 x 23
Prime factors of 645 are 3 x 5 x 43
The above numbers do not have any common prime factor. So GCD is 1
